Visit Wat Chiang Man, the oldest temple in Chiang Mai, founded in 1297 by King Mengrai. This temple represents early Lanna architecture and marks an important spiritual and historical foundation of the city. Learn about its architectural details and its role during the early formation of Chiang Mai. As we ride through the heart of the Old City, we stop at the iconic Three Kings Monument, a symbolic landmark honoring the three northern kings who founded Chiang Mai in the 13th century. Here, your guide will share how their alliance shaped the Lanna Kingdom and laid the foundations of the city you see today. Cycle onward to Wat Phra Singh, one of Northern Thailand’s most important temples. Known for its elegant Lanna-style architecture and spiritual significance, this temple offers insight into Buddhist art, symbolism, and the continuing role of Buddhism in everyday life in Chiang Mai. Ride toward the Ping River and stop at the historic Iron Bridge, a landmark that once played an important role in Chiang Mai’s trade and transportation network. Enjoy scenic river views and take in the atmosphere of this riverside area, which reflects the city’s historical connections and development over time. Continue to Warorot Market (Kad Luang), one of the oldest and most vibrant local markets in Chiang Mai. Here, you will observe daily life as residents shop for fresh produce, spices, and traditional snacks that reflect authentic Northern Thai food culture.
